What the vulnerability does
01Description
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in CurrencyRate.Today Crypto Converter Widget allows Stored XSS.This issue affects Crypto Converter Widget: from n/a through 1.8.4.
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ms
02Summary
The Crypto Converter Widget contains a stored c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ability that allows authenticated users to inject malicious scripts. When a victim visits a page containing the widget, the injected code executes in their browser with access to their session. The vulnerability requires user interaction and affects conf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the affected site.
What an attacker can do
03Attacker Capabilities
Inject malicious JavaScript that runs in visitors' browsers and steals session data or performs actions on their behalf.
Potential impact on your site
04Site Impact
Visitors' accounts and data are at risk if an authenticated user injects malicious code into the widget.
Conditions required to exploit
05Prerequisites
Attacker needs a low-privilege account on the site; victim must view a page with the malicious widget content.
